The Location and Setting

The experience takes place in Pantelleria, a small island known for its volcanic origins and stunning landscapes. Your journey begins at a central meeting point—Piazza Cavour in front of Pasticceria da Giovanni—which makes it easy to find your guides. From there, you’ll be transported to a remarkable, active crater—a landscape that looks more like a scene from a fantasy film than a typical tour destination.

What sets this apart is the location’s natural drama. The crater is still active, which adds a sense of raw power and mystery to the setting. As the sun dips below the horizon, the scenery transitions from daylight to a twilight glow, then to a star-studded sky. The view across the sea to Tunisia is breathtaking, providing a reminder of how close Sicily is to Africa—and how vast and diverse the Mediterranean really is.

Practical Details

The tour lasts approximately 3 hours, with starting times available depending on availability. It’s recommended to check ahead for specific schedules. The meeting point is conveniently located at Piazza Cavour, and the activity ends back at the same spot, simplifying logistics.

Transportation is arranged from the meeting point to the crater, ensuring a stress-free experience. The tour is available in multiple languages—Czech, English, and Italian—making it accessible for a diverse range of travelers.

The cancellation policy is flexible, allowing full refunds if canceled 24 hours in advance, which is reassuring for anyone hesitant about last-minute changes.
